数据库更新记录命令是什么

不及物动词 其他 15

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库更新记录的命令通常是使用SQL语言来执行的。SQL是结构化查询语言(Structured Query Language)的缩写,是一种用于管理和操作关系型数据库的标准语言。

    在SQL中,用于更新记录的命令是UPDATE语句。UPDATE语句用于修改表中的数据,可以更新一条或多条记录。以下是UPDATE语句的基本语法:

    UPDATE 表名
    SET 列名1 = 值1, 列名2 = 值2, ...
    WHERE 条件;
    

    其中,表名指定要更新的表的名称,列名和值对应要更新的列和新的值。WHERE子句可选,用于指定更新的条件,只有满足条件的记录才会被更新。

    以下是UPDATE语句的详细用法和注意事项:

    1. 更新单条记录:
    UPDATE 表名
    SET 列名1 = 值1, 列名2 = 值2, ...
    WHERE 条件;
    

    这个语句将满足条件的记录的指定列更新为指定的值。

    1. 更新多条记录:
    UPDATE 表名
    SET 列名1 = 值1, 列名2 = 值2, ...
    WHERE 条件;
    

    这个语句将满足条件的所有记录的指定列更新为指定的值。

    1. 更新多个列:
    UPDATE 表名
    SET 列名1 = 值1, 列名2 = 值2, ...
    WHERE 条件;
    

    这个语句可以一次更新多个列的值。

    1. 使用子查询更新记录:
    UPDATE 表名
    SET 列名 = (SELECT 子查询)
    WHERE 条件;
    

    这个语句可以使用子查询的结果来更新记录的某个列。

    1. 注意事项:
    • 在更新记录之前,应该先备份数据,以防止意外操作导致数据丢失。
    • 更新记录时应该谨慎使用WHERE子句,确保只更新目标记录,避免误操作。
    • 更新记录可能会导致数据不一致,应该在更新前进行充分的测试和验证。
    • 更新记录可能会对数据库性能产生影响,特别是在更新大量记录时,应该考虑优化更新操作的方式。
    • 更新操作应该在事务中进行,以确保数据的一致性和完整性。
    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库更新记录的命令通常是使用SQL语言中的UPDATE语句来实现。UPDATE语句用于修改数据库表中的记录。

    UPDATE语句的基本语法如下:

    UPDATE table_name
    SET column1 = value1, column2 = value2, ...
    WHERE condition;
    

    其中,table_name是要更新记录的表的名称,column1column2等是要更新的列名,value1value2等是要更新的值,condition是筛选要更新的记录的条件。

    具体来说,以下是UPDATE语句的各个部分的作用:

    • table_name:指定要更新记录的表的名称。
    • SET:指定要更新的列和新值。
    • column1 = value1, column2 = value2, ...:指定要更新的列和对应的新值。可以同时更新多个列。
    • WHERE:用于筛选要更新的记录。
    • condition:指定筛选记录的条件。只有满足该条件的记录才会被更新。

    举个例子,假设有一个名为students的表,其中包含idnameage三个列。现在要将id为1的学生的姓名更新为"Tom",年龄更新为18,可以使用如下的UPDATE语句:

    UPDATE students
    SET name = 'Tom', age = 18
    WHERE id = 1;
    

    执行该语句后,满足条件的记录(id为1的记录)会被更新,将姓名修改为"Tom",年龄修改为18。

    需要注意的是,UPDATE语句是一种非常强大的操作数据库记录的工具,但在使用时需要谨慎,确保更新的记录和条件正确,避免误操作。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库更新记录的命令通常是SQL语句中的UPDATE语句。UPDATE语句用于修改数据库表中的数据。下面是UPDATE语句的基本语法:

    UPDATE 表名
    SET 列名1=新值1, 列名2=新值2, …
    WHERE 条件;

    其中,表名是需要更新数据的表名;列名是要更新的列名;新值是要更新的新值;条件是用于筛选要更新的记录的条件。

    下面是一个具体的示例:

    UPDATE students
    SET age=20, grade='A'
    WHERE id=1;

    上面的示例中,我们将id为1的学生的年龄更新为20,成绩更新为A。

    除了UPDATE语句,还有其他一些相关的命令和操作可以用于更新数据库记录。下面是一些常见的操作流程:

    1. 使用SELECT语句查询要更新的记录,以确认要更新的数据。

    SELECT * FROM students WHERE id=1;

    1. 根据查询结果,构建UPDATE语句,更新数据。

    UPDATE students
    SET age=20, grade='A'
    WHERE id=1;

    1. 执行UPDATE语句,更新数据库记录。

    2. 使用SELECT语句再次查询更新后的记录,以确认数据已经更新。

    SELECT * FROM students WHERE id=1;

    注意事项:

    • 在更新数据之前,一定要仔细检查更新语句和条件,确保更新的数据和条件是正确的。
    • 更新语句通常要在事务中执行,以确保数据的一致性。
    • 在更新数据之前,最好备份数据库,以防止意外情况导致数据丢失或错误。
    • 在更新大量数据时,可以使用批量更新操作,以提高效率。
    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部